Target Background

Function
(From Uniprot)
Ligand for receptors NMUR1 and NMUR2. Stimulates muscle contractions of specific regions of the gastrointestinal tract.; Does not function as a ligand for either NMUR1 or NMUR2. Indirectly induces prolactin release although its potency is much lower than that of neuromedin precursor-related peptide 36.; Does not function as a ligand for either NMUR1 or NMUR2. Indirectly induces prolactin release from lactotroph cells in the pituitary gland, probably via the hypothalamic dopaminergic system.; Stimulates muscle contractions of specific regions of the gastrointestinal tract.
Gene References into Functions
  1. These data indicate a novel role for the peripheral NMU system, providing new insights into the pathogenesis of NAFLD/NASH. PMID: 29017855
  2. Loss of NMU-NMUR1 signalling reduced ILC2 frequency and effector function, and altered transcriptional programs following allergen challenge in vivo. Thus, NMUR1 signalling promotes inflammatory ILC2 responses, highlighting the importance of neuro-immune crosstalk in allergic inflammation at mucosal surfaces. PMID: 28902842
  3. data indicate that the NMU-NMUR1 neuronal signaling circuit provides a selective mechanism through which the enteric nervous system and innate immune system integrate to promote rapid type 2 cytokine responses that can induce anti-microbial, inflammatory and tissue-protective type 2 responses at mucosal sites PMID: 28869965
  4. NMU treatment in vivo resulted in immediate protective type 2 responses; accordingly, group 2 innate lymphoid cells -autonomous ablation of Nmur1 led to impaired type 2 responses and poor control of worm infection PMID: 28869974
  5. These results suggested that NMU can act directly on beta cells through NMUR1 in an autocrine or paracrine fashion to suppress insulin secretion. Collectively, our results highlight the crucial role of NMU in suppressing pancreatic insulin secretion, and may improve our understanding of glucose homeostasis. PMID: 28864416
  6. These results suggest that NMU and NMS are involved in thermoregulation via the prostaglandin E2 and beta3 adrenergic receptors, but that endogenous NMS might play a more predominant role than NMU. PMID: 26826380
  7. the anorectic effect of the lipidated NMU is partly mediated by a decrease in gastric emptying which is subject to tachyphylaxis after continuous dosing. PMID: 25895852
  8. Beta-adrenergic and cholinergic mechanisms are involved in the anxiolytic action of neuromedin-U. PMID: 23892031
  9. Data show that neuromedin U (NMU)-deficient mice developed less severe arthritis than control mice. PMID: 22314006
  10. investigation of neuromedin U effects on factors associated with obesity/diabetes: NMU reduced food consumption/body weight; NMU increased body temperature/metabolic rate; NMU improved glucose tolerance; these effects seem to be mediated by NMUR1 PMID: 21586559
  11. Analysis of NMU expression in ob/ob mice revealed elevated NMU mRNA levels in the dorsomedial hypothalamic (DMH) nucleus of ob/ob mice compared to lean litter-mates. NMU mRNA levels were elevated in the DMH of mice fasted for 24 h relative to controls PMID: 14622096
  12. results suggest that endogenous NMU may be involved in reflexes and adaptation to environmental stimuli PMID: 15369794
  13. NMU plays an important role in the regulation of feeding behavior and energy metabolism independent of the leptin signaling pathway. PMID: 15448684
  14. NMU receptor antagonists could be novel targets for pharmacological inhibition of allergic inflammatory diseases, including asthma. PMID: 16373672
  15. data suggest that LPS-induced IL-6 expression is partly dependent on autocrine/paracrine activation of the NMU-NMU-R1 signals in macrophages PMID: 16466693
  16. A study evaluating smooth muscle contraction in NMU1 receptor knockout mouse was used to determine which receptor subtype mediates the contractile responses generated by neuromedin in the mouse.[NMU1 receptor] PMID: 16474416
  17. results indicate that NMU suppresses gonadotropin secretion and regulates the onset of puberty PMID: 16716306
  18. Central control of bone remodeling by Nmu is reported. PMID: 17873881
  19. negative regulator of bone formation through the molecular clock PMID: 18761104
  20. proNMU(104-136) is a novel modulator of energy balance and may contribute to the phenotype exhibited by NMU knockout mice. PMID: 19531638
